Spring Island’s 33 Little Neck Crossing featured as ‘Unreal Estate’

A Spring Island home with marsh views, 33 Little Neck Crossing, is featured throughout Canada’s Sun Media group as “Unreal Estate.”

Sun Media highlights the architecture of this five-bedroom, five-bathroom home listed at $2.55 million:

Nearly 5,000 square feet of sophisticated architectural design, this Spring Island home was designed by prominent South Carolina architect Jim Thomas, whose firm Thomas & Denzinger has won multiple awards from that state’s chapter of the American Institute of Architects.

The main entry is a two-storey glass tower, the centrepiece of which is a magnificent custom-designed suspended curvilinear stairway.

Ultra-high-quality materials like bluestone and Brazilian walnut floors complement features like vaulted ceilings, fireplaces and walls of windows with stunning views of the salt marshes on one side and the nature preserve on the other.

Spring Island is a 3,000-acre South Carolina Lowcountry golf community located 25 minutes from Hilton Head and Beaufort, and 30 minutes by boat from Port Royal Sound and the open Atlantic Ocean. Spring Island is limited to no more than 410 families, with 1,200 acres protected as nature preserve.
